Why Choose Solid Wood Interior Doors Over Alternatives?

Compared to hollow core and lightweight engineered substrates, custom stave-core hardwood doors stand out for their substantial density, sound attenuation capabilities, and decades-long physical durability.

Standard hollow-core doors quickly warp and allow unwanted acoustics to leak between living spaces. Our engineered wood technology utilizes layered timber cross-lamination to restrict shifting, keeping the frame linear.

If you prefer a sleek, minimalist look instead of traditional wood, you can also explore our custom Sliding Door Room Dividers or steel and glass doors.

Feature Solid Wood Engineered Wood Hollow Core
Durability High Medium Low
Sound Control Excellent Good Basic
Refinishing Yes Limited No
Longevity Excellent Good Moderate

Frequent Asked Questions

Will solid wood interior doors warp in Vancouver’s climate?

Solid wood can react to humidity changes (swell in wet months, shrink in dry months). Proper finishing, conditioning, and correct installation greatly reduce the risk of warping. Keep indoor humidity balanced and avoid direct prolonged moisture exposure.

Are solid wood interior doors energy efficient?

Solid wood has natural insulating properties but is usually less insulating than insulated fiberglass or steel doors. For interior use, wood helps with thermal buffering between rooms; pairing with good weatherstripping and seals improves efficiency.

Do solid wood interior doors help with soundproofing?

Yes — solid wood doors generally provide better sound reduction than hollow-core doors. Acoustic performance is often described using STC (Sound Transmission Class); higher-mass solid doors will have better STC ratings. If sound control is critical, ask about door cores, seals, and certified STC performance.
